Lines Matching refs:seq

478     def __init__(self, seq):  argument
479 self.seq = seq
481 for pair in seq: # (cond, code) pair
491 return '{0}({1!r})'.format(self.__class__.__name__, self.seq)
531 return self.seq.pack(data, conditions)
742 seq = self.pfods[cls].seq
747 seq = dotl.pfods[rrd.Rlerror].seq
753 seq.unpack(vdict, self.conditions, data, noerror)
1451 def _debug_print_sequencer(seq): argument
1453 print('sequencer is {0!r}'.format(seq), file=sys.stderr)
1454 for i, enc in enumerate(seq):
1457 def _parse_expr(seq, string, typedefs): argument
1551 seq.append_encdec(condval, encdec)
1573 seq.append_encdec(condval, encdec)
1588 seq.append_encdec(condval, encdec)
1755 seq = sequencer.Sequencer(name)
1756 fields = _parse_expr(seq, expr, self.typedefs)
1767 _debug_print_sequencer(seq)
1770 self.typedefs[name] = cls, seq
1798 seq = sequencer.Sequencer(name)
1799 fields = _parse_expr(seq, expr, self.typedefs)
1804 _debug_print_sequencer(seq)
1807 self.protocol[name] = cls, value, proto_version, seq
1823 seq = sequencer.Sequencer('Header-pack')
1825 seq.append_encdec(None, sequencer.EncDecSimple('size', 4, None))
1827 seq.append_encdec(None, sequencer.EncDecSimple('fcall', 1, None))
1829 seq.append_encdec(None, sequencer.EncDecA('dsize', 'data', None))
1832 _debug_print_sequencer(seq)
1833 self.header_pack_seq = seq
1835 seq = sequencer.Sequencer('Header-unpack')
1836 seq.append_encdec(None, sequencer.EncDecSimple('fcall', 1, None))
1837 seq.append_encdec(None, sequencer.EncDecA('dsize', 'data', None))
1840 _debug_print_sequencer(seq)
1841 self.header_unpack_seq = seq
1913 seq = val[3]
1914 packinfo = _PackInfo(seq)